Ingredients
1 lb pork rib - blanched
1 pkt sea cucumber (frozen fresh) - cleaned and blanched
3 pcs dried fish maw - blanched
2 shitake mushrooms - soaked, drained and trimmed
1 carrot - cut into thick slices
2 slices ginger
2 cloves garlic - lightly smashed
1 shallot - peeled and sliced into halves
1 tbsp oil for frying
1 to 2 cups water
Sauce
1 tbsp shaoxing wine
1 tbsp oyster sauce
1 tbsp soy sauce
Method
- Heat up oil in a pan. Saute ginger, garlic and shallot till lightly aromatic.
- Fry pork ribs and mushrooms for 1 to 2 minutes. Drizzle sauce and do a quick stir fry. Add water and bring to a boil. Simmer for another 30 minutes.
- Add carrot, sea cucumber and fish maw and simmer for another 30 minutes.
- Drizzle sesame oil and transfer to a serving plate. Serve warm with rice.

Ingredients
fettucinne pasta
smoked salmon
cherry tomatoes
dried basil leaves
toasted pine nuts
shredded cheese blend
extra virgin olive oil
Method
- Cook pasta according to package instructions.
- Drain and set aside on a serving plate.
- Drizzle olive oil and add shredded cheese. Toss to mix.
- Add cherry tomatoes, smoked salmon, pine nuts and sprinkle basil leaves. Toss to mix well and serve warm.
